In Indianapolis, Mike Wells reports the Pacers have hired former NFLer CALVIN HILL as Consultant to "help the team with its image reshaping." Hill, who has played "a vital part as a consultant in helping the Dallas Cowboys clean up their image," will work with Pacers VP/Player Relations SAM PERKINS (INDIANAPOLIS STAR, 10/10).
EXECS: English Premier League club Newcastle United VP/Player Recruitment TONY JIMENEZ announced he is leaving the team to "pursue other interests" (London TELEGRAPH, 10/10)….The AHL Worcester Sharks promoted MICHAEL MUDD to Senior VP/Hockey & Business Administration (Sharks)....Southeast Missouri State Univ. fired AD DON KAVERMAN “three days after the NCAA notified the school of possible major violations.” In addition, men’s basketball coach SCOTT EDGAR was placed on “administrative leave until February 7, 2009, when his contract will end.” Associate AD CINDY GANNON was appointed interim AD (AP, 10/9)….Suburban Sports Group (SSG) named CHUCK STEVENS Graphics Designer (SSG).
